May 15, 2012 12:54 PM

Where can I find crumpets?

Anyone know where I can find crumpets - english muffin's cousin :)

Anywhere in greater Boston would do.

    1. re: CookieLee

      Hi thanks for responding. Which Star Market has them? Do you have an address?

      1. re: afarooqs

        I get them at the Star Mkt on rte 9 in Chestnut Hill, and the small one on Beacon St. in Brookline. I used to live in the UK, and they're pretty close to the original.

    2. I've seen them at Whole Foods as well. Dedham and Brookline for sure.

      1. re: purple bot

        i buy them all the time at market basket

      2. They are in nearly every supermarket around here, next to the English muffins. Stop and Shop, Star, Trader Joe's, etc..

        1. Most Market baskets stock them, good price to , trader joe has them as well, great toasted with honey, yum

          1. Roche Bros also carries them. They are in the bakery section, but they are not "home made". My wife is English and she eats them so I assume they are at least half decent.